Investigation of Reservoirs Ice Covers with Different Salinity Using the GNSS Reflectometry
https://doi.org/10.1134/S1062873824709371
In the period from winter to spring 2024, a series of measurements of interference reflectograms from layered structures of ice surfaces of freshwater and salt reservoirs of the Krasnoyarsk Territory and the Republic of Khakassia were carried out. These measurements were performed using signals from navigation satellites operating in the L1 band. The experimental data obtained in the form of amplitude-time dependencies were processed using the fast Fourier transform algorithm. Subsequent analysis of the measurement processing results allowed us to conclude that the GNSS reflectometry method is highly sensitive to determining the macrophysical characteristics of ice surfaces with different salinity of reservoirs.
